JUPITER IS THE COMPLETE PACKAGE
Jupiter is one of those once-in-a-lifetime dogs. At just four years old, this lovable mixed-breed girl is the full package: sweet, smart, and full of personality. She’s already earned an impressive list of credentials—she knows how to sit, lay down, roll over, spin, and even kennel. Talk about an A+ student?!
AdoptADog Photography
ONE BIG LOVER
She likes kids and gets along well with cats, but she hasn’t been tested around other dogs yet, so a proper introduction would be needed if you already have a pup at home. But this much is clear: Jupiter is ready to love big. She wants to be by your side, go for walks, and be your favorite cuddle buddy at the end of the day.

Just like she is an A+ student, she is also 100+ pounds—something she’ll need your help managing. Like many of us, she’s been a little too enthusiastic about snacks (I can relate).

She’s also sensitive. Jupiter doesn’t care for snowmen, sprinklers, or fire hydrants—likely due to something in her past. Or maybe she watched some horror movies that included all of the above. Whatever the reason, you might live in a more rural area, and those may not even be part of her world anymore.
JUPITER’S ADOPTION FEE HAS BEEN PAID!
And here’s the best part: Jupiter’s adoption fee has already been paid, thanks to a generous TCHS donor who simply wants to see her find her forever home. That means if you have the heart and the home, she’s ready to walk into your life today. I’m hoping that she won’t have to spend days 61, 62, or 63 without a home.
